Открыто

Kafka на Java с нуля [stepik] [Николай Степанов]

Тема в разделе "Курсы по программированию", создана пользователем Топикстартер, 20 июн 2025.

Основной список: 8 участников

Резервный список: 5 участников

  1. 20 июн 2025
    #1
    Топикстартер
    Топикстартер ЧКЧлен клуба

    Складчина: Kafka на Java с нуля [stepik] [Николай Степанов]

    2.jpg

    Научитесь работать с Apache Kafka — мощной платформой для потоковой обработки данных в реальном времени. В этом курсе вы освоите архитектуру Kafka, клиентские API (Producer, Consumer, Admin), обработку потоков с помощью Kafka Streams, интеграцию через Kafka Connect и работу с Spring Kafka и Schema Registry. Практические задания и проекты помогут закрепить навыки для использования Kafka в микросервисах, анализе логов и event-driven архитектуре.

    Чему вы научитесь
    Применять Apache Kafka для потоковой передачи и обработки данных в реальном времени
    Разрабатывать приложения с использованием Kafka Producer и Consumer API
    Обрабатывать данные с помощью Kafka Streams (DSL и Processor API)
    Настраивать коннекторы Kafka Connect для интеграции внешних систем
    Использовать Spring Kafka и Schema Registry в проектах
    Тестировать и оптимизировать приложения Kafka
    Строить отказоустойчивые и масштабируемые event-driven архитектуры

    О курсе
    Этот курс — ваш практический гид по Apache Kafka, одной из самых востребованных технологий для работы с потоками данных в реальном времени. Вы не просто изучите теорию, а сразу примените знания на практике:
    • От основ к продвинутым темам – начнете с архитектуры Kafka и клиентских API (Producer, Consumer, Admin), а затем перейдете к обработке данных с Kafka Streams, интеграции через Kafka Connect и работе с Spring Kafka.
    • Реальные кейсы – научитесь настраивать Kafka для микросервисов, мониторинга логов, event-driven архитектур и других задач.
    • Практика через код – каждый урок содержит упражнения, викторины и демонстрации, а в конце вас ждет итоговый проект, который можно добавить в портфолио.
    • Лучшие практики и оптимизация – узнаете, как тестировать, масштабировать и настраивать Kafka для надежной работы в production.
    Курс подойдет тем, кто хочет не просто познакомиться с Kafka, а научиться применять её в реальных проектах – от потоковой аналитики до построения распределенных систем.

    Для кого этот курс
    Разработчики, желающие освоить Kafka для работы с большими данными и event-driven системами
    Инженеры данных, создающие конвейеры обработки данных в реальном времени
    Специалисты по данным, которым нужна надежная потоковая инфраструктура
    Архитекторы, проектирующие микросервисные и слабосвязанные системы

    Начальные требования
    Базовый опыт программирования на Java (желательно)
    Знание основ распределенных систем (полезно, но не обязательно)
    Умение работать с терминалом

    Наши преподаватели.Николай Степанов .Инженер DevOps и преподаватель.
    Помогаю освоить современные инструменты DevOps и контейнерные технологии. Участвовал в разработке обучающих программ для IT-специалистов.

    Как проходит обучение
    Теория: лекции с примерами и лучшими практиками
    Демонстрации: работа с Kafka Producer, Consumer, Streams и Connect

    Программа курса
    Введение
    1. Обзор курса
    2. Установка и настройка среды
    3. Архитектура Apache Kafka
    4. Клиентские библиотеки Apache Kafka
    5. Библиотека Java-клиента Apache Kafka

    Producer и Consumer API
    1.API продюсера Kafka
    2.Конфигурация и лучшие практики API производителя Kafka
    3. API потребителя Kafka
    4. Использование Kafka как темы и очереди
    5. Конфигурация и лучшие практики для API потребителя

    Kafka Streams
    1.Введение в Kafka Streams
    2.Обзор stateless операций DSL API
    3. Использование Stateless-операций DSL API
    4. Состояния операций DSL API: Агрегация
    5. Операции объединения в DSL API
    6. Оконные функции в DSL API Kafka Streams
    7. Интерактивные запросы
    8. Тестирование приложений Kafka Streams

    Kafka Connect
    1.Введение в Kafka Connect
    2. Коннекторы источников Kafka Connect
    3. Коннекторы Sink для Kafka Connect
    4. Трансформации в Kafka Connect

    Проекты в экосистеме Kafka
    1.Основы Spring Kafka
    2.Приложения производителя и потребителя
    3.Основы работы с Реестром Схем
    4.Использование Avro в приложениях производителя и потребителя
    5.Kafka MirrorMaker
    Заключение

    В курс входят 28 уроков 44 теста .Последнее обновление 18.06.2025
    Цена: 489 р
    Скрытая ссылка
     
    Последнее редактирование модератором: 20 июн 2025
    1 человеку нравится это.
  2. Последние события

    1. Gueribell
      Gueribell не участвует.
      21 июл 2025
    2. Javaist
      Javaist участвует.
      19 июл 2025
    3. skladchik.com
      Взнос составляет 0р.
      18 июл 2025
    4. skladchik.com
      Нужен организатор складчины.
      18 июл 2025

    Последние важные события

    1. skladchik.com
      Взнос составляет 0р.
      18 июл 2025
    2. skladchik.com
      Нужен организатор складчины.
      18 июл 2025
    3. skladchik.com
      Складчина открыта.
      18 июл 2025
    4. skladchik.com
      Взнос составляет 161р.
      9 июл 2025